    Rinconcito Peruano is Peruvian home cooking at its best. I really don't know why I haven't written a review of this place before... I have been coming here for years. Even before they had a restaurant ! When visiting Rinconcito Peruano order the fish ceviche, choros a la chalaca, Jalea mixta and maybe a Parihuela. I know it is a lot of food so either bring friends or take a few trips. You will like them all. The Parihuela soup is excellent, lots of seafood and a touch of spiciness that keeps drawing you in. Jalea mixta is this dish with all fried seafood (delicious). If you like drinks try the passion fruit pisco. This unpretentious restaurant delivers in food and in service. Thumbs up

    What an experience! First, it's a fish market. You pick out…read morewhat you want to eat (and they're very helpful if you're not sure what you're looking for.) Then you tell them how you'd like it cooked. They cook it up nicely! (Warning, if you go for the fish and chips, it's a cornbread batter, not a beer batter.) Some of the best lobster. Delicious eats, attentive and friendly staff. I'd go again when in the area.

    My first visit here and I sort of wish I'd read the other reviews before I came here. If so, I…read morewould have come at a time where I was hungry and for a mere five dollars had them prepare my meal for me. But that being said, I found it to be a very nice fish market. Now there is a huge downside that you immediately encounter when you arrive. The parking lot is exceptionally small and people are parked every which way, except in the spaces. Getting to the actual building will take some time. The neighboring lots have pretty clear signs that they will tell you if you park there. So you're stuck dealing with what it is. The fish variety is good, although not great. If you're looking for strictly local fish, you'll probably find what you want. Several varieties of snapper and the fish looked wonderful and fresh. Some of my favorites like hogfish and grouper. You can buy the whole fish and they'll fillet it for you or you can buy fillets if they have them of the fish that you want. But the part I missed is having them cook it for me. Now that is something I would like to try next time The downside is they strictly local fish. You won't find any flatfish and I was surprised that they did not have any U4 or U6 shrimp which I like to use to make paella. In addition, I did not see fresh scallops. They did have some nice lobster tails although I did not see other shellfish. Some people have said the prices are reasonable; I found them about 20 to 30% higher than other fish markets I visit. The people here are really nice in the market is attractive. I will be back as I said to get a meal cooked for me in part because it is closer than the fish markets I usually visit and also my curiosity after reading other reviews. I recommend this market if you have the patience to wait for a parking space. If you're looking for the larger shrimp for paella look elsewhere
